Jon Cronin, Content Creation
Jon is Head of Broadcast and Content at Lansons, a leading UK reputation management consultancy. With more than a decade of experience as a senior journalist at the BBC, Jon has a rich background in television, radio and online news.
Before joining the BBC, he honed his storytelling skills as a newspaper reporter across various publications in London, building a deep understanding of how to shape narratives that resonate with audiences.
From his London-base, Jon brings his wealth of experience and sharp editorial instincts to his role at Lansons, where he leads the creation and curation of high-quality content for a range of clients.
